Description
A refreshing and vibrant salad perfect for your next barbecue, featuring crisp vegetables and a zesty dressing.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 head of romaine lettuce, chopped
- 2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 cup corn kernels (fresh or frozen)
- 1 can (15 oz) black beans, rinsed and drained
- 1 red onion, thinly sliced
- 1/2 cup chopped fresh cilantro
- For the dressing: 1/4 cup olive oil, 2 tablespoons lime juice, 1 teaspoon honey, sal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ine chopped romaine lettuce, halved cherry tomatoes, corn kernels, rinsed black beans, and sliced red onion.
- In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lime juice, honey, salt, and pepper for the dressing.
- Pour the dressing over the salad ingredients.
- Add chopped fresh cilantro.
- Toss everything gently to combine.
- Serve immediately as a side dish for your barbecue.
Notes
- You can add grilled chicken or shrimp for a more substantial salad.
- For a spicier kick, add a pinch of chili powder to the dressing.
- This salad can be made ahead of time; store dressing separately and toss just before serving.
